Aoife Carragher has been part of the AA Roadwatch team since March 2008. Most mornings you will hear Aoife on 2fm’s Breakfast with Hector, but she also broadcasts on other 2fm shows and occasionally on RTÉ Lyric Fm and on RTÉ Radio One. In May 2011, and after three years with AA Roadwatch, Aoife took on the new role of Roadwatch Team Leader.
Before joining Roadwatch Aoife worked as a researcher and reporter on LMFM Radio’s flagship current affairs programme The Micheal Reade Show. Aoife completed a degree in Media Studies and German in NUI Maynooth, and as part of her course she spent a year in Bremen where she improved her time keeping skills and topped up the German vocab! In 2010 Aoife undertook an MA in Public Affairs and Political Communications with DIT Angier St. As part of her MA and as well as juggling the traffic, Aoife worked with two Senators in Leinster House and took part in the General Election 2011 campaign.
Although Aoife is a native of Castleblayney in Co. Monaghan, she didn’t fancy the early morning commute and so has been living in Dublin since she started with AA Roadwatch.
